Drained and Undrained Analysis


GTL

in undrained conditions, excess pore pressures are built up


∆u ≠ 0, ∆σ ≠ ∆σ'

in drained conditions, no excess pore pressures are built up


∆u = 0, ∆σ = ∆σ'

• drained analysis appropriate when


– permeability is high
– rate of loading is low
– short term behavior is not of interest for problem considered

• undrained analysis appropriate when


– permeability is low and rate of loading is high
– short term behavior has to be assessed

Skempton’s Parameters A and B


GTL

a few notes on parameters A and B:

– for Kw large compared to K', parameter B ~ 1.0


(corresponds to ∆p w = ∆p > ∆p' = 0)
– small amount of air (lack of saturation) reduces
parameter B significantly (see next figure)

– "parameter" A depends on stress path: for a given


model, it cannot be determined a priori but is a result
of the model behavior for the stress path followed

Modeling Undrained Behavior with PLAXIS


GTL

method A (analysis in terms of effective stresses):


type of material behaviour: undrained
effective strength parameters c', ϕ', ψ'
effective stiffness parameters E50', ν'

method B (analysis in terms of effective stresses):


type of material behaviour: undrained
total strength parameters c = cu, ϕ = 0, ψ = 0
effective stiffness parameters E50', ν'

method C (analysis in terms of total stresses):


type of material behaviour: drained
total strength parameters c = cu, ϕ = 0, ψ = 0
total stiffness parameters Eu, νu = 0.495

FE Modeling of Undrained Behavior (method A)


GTL

all the above (which is valid for any soil for which the principle
of effective stress applies) can be easily combined with the FEM

• instead of specifying the components of D, specify D'‚ and Ke

D = D '+ D f then same as in the drained case


• when calculating stresses,

∆p f = K e ∆ε v
∆σ = ∆σ '+ ∆σ f
∆σ ' = D ' ∆ε
a value must be set for Ke

the pore-fluid is assigned a bulk modulus that is substantially


larger than that of the soil skeleton (which ensures that during
undrained loading the volumetric strains are very small)

What PLAXIS does


GTL

PLAXIS automatically adds stiffness of water when undrained


material type is chosen using the following approximation:

Kw Eu 2 G (1 + ν u )
K total = K ' + = =
n 3(1 − 2 νu ) 3(1 − 2ν u )

E' (1 + ν u )
K total = assuming νu = 0.495
3(1 − 2 ν u ) (1 + ν')

Notes:
• this procedure gives reasonable B-values only for ν' < 0.35 !
• real value of Kw/n ~ 1•10 6 kPa (for n = 0.5)
• in Version 8 B-value can be entered explicitely for undrained materials

Summary
GTL

• FEM analysis of undrained conditions can be performed in


effective stresses and with effective stiffness and strength
parameters
• Undrained shear strength is a result of the constitutive
model
• Care must be taken with the choice of the value for
dilatancy angle
à note that for NC soils in general:
• factor of safety against failure is lower for short term
(undrained) conditions for loading problems (e.g.
embankment )
• factor of safety against failure is lower for long term
(drained) conditions for unloading problems (e.g.
excavations )
